Przemysl I of Poland

Przemysł I (1220/21June 4, 1257), was a duke of Greater Poland (the provinces of Poznań, Kalisz, and Gniezno).

He was born to Ladislaus Odonic Plwacz, duke of Greater Poland, and Jadwiga of Pomerania, daughter of Mestwin I, duke of Eastern Pomerania.


Born: 1220 or 1221
Realm of power:
1239-1247 Duke of Greater Poland, together with his brother Boleslaus the Pious
1247-1249 Duke of Poznań and Gniezno
1249-1250 Duke of Poznań and Kalisz
1250-1253 Duke of Greater Poland (Poznań, Gniezno and Kalisz)
1253-1257 Duke of Poznań
Died 4 June 1257

Maried to Elisabeth of Silesia, daughter of Henry II the Pious, duke of Silesia;
Children: Przemysł II
